Output 73d8295b695c3c6e83c41967fa85741708213833b92152a3ec256656d6f89d92:0

value
44070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da47608b2ea1e7c0cb342e618309d22e6b476193 OP_EQUALVERIFY OP_CHECKSIG
address
1Lu9pBwE7M5a2p5iQuvP1kjooLWcq2HjNs
transaction
73d8295b695c3c6e83c41967fa85741708213833b92152a3ec256656d6f89d92
spent
true